Runbook: Parcelwing webhook intake. The tracking webhook from the Hollom depot fires on every scan event and must verify the HMAC signature before processing. Rotation happens quarterly; the old signing key stays valid for 24 hours after cutover. The verifier reads its signing key from the environment, set on the line below.

sealed setting: ARCHIVE_KEY3=8d0

## 3.2.0 — Watchdog defaults changed

The Pinegate kiosk watchdog no longer reboots the device on first heartbeat miss. Default behavior is now: restart the foreground app twice, then escalate to a full reboot. Heartbeat interval shortened, grace period after boot lengthened to avoid false positives during OS updates. Anyone maintaining the Dellhaven fleet should note these defaults override per-site files unless explicitly pinned. The shipped defaults are as follows:

service settings:
[casax]
port = 6379
team = rusir
host = casax.zemvarhq.corp
region = outer-4
access_code = ac_9808ce
timeout_ms = 1500

MEMO — Notarised deed transfer. The Hollinvale deed was notarised this morning and must reach the Brayton registry office today. Original only; no copies leave the building. Courier booked with Tarnwick Secure for 14:00 pick-up at reception. Envelope stays sealed, signature on delivery required. Release the envelope only after the rider states this phrase:

courier memo of yawep-yafog: the pramir ulaix courier leaves the ulavan aldix frair zorok oliiel joreth rusdor fenvan ledger at gate 1305 under passcode 514738

Ticket IMG-locked: Vault sealed during leak investigation

While profiling the Snapcache memory leak in the Orvell image service, the diagnostics vault auto-sealed after the heap-dump job crashed mid-write. We need the vault unsealed to retrieve the captured dumps before Thursday's sync. Unseal via the standard recovery flow on the bastion; enter the passphrase below when prompted.

unlock words, tajep-fafof: fraiel-wenvan-gorox-jorox-wenok-sorion-fenion